8 padomi vietnes paātrināšanai

Pat ja nav nekā cita, par ko esmu pārliecināts, viena lieta noteikti ir pārliecināta – jūs jau iepriekš esat saskāries ar vismaz vienu sāpīgi lēnu vietni savā dzīvē. Ja tas jums izklausās pazīstams, ļaujiet man nodot dažus padomus, ko esmu ieguvis dažu pēdējo gadu laikā, un kas var palīdzēt jums paātrināt jūsu vietni.


Ja neesat pārliecināts, ka vietnes ātrums jums ir svarīgs, tad padomājiet par laiku, kurā esat arī aizvēris pārlūka logu, gaidot vietnes ielādi. Fakts ir tāds, ka 53% cilvēku atsakās no vietnes, kuras ielāde prasa vairāk nekā 3 sekundes.

Jūsu vietnes veiktspējai ir nozīme, un tā ietekmē jūsu meklētājprogrammu klasifikāciju. Piemēram, Google dod priekšroku ātrām vietnēm un piešķir šos augstākos rangus meklēšanas rezultātos.

Vidējais tīmekļa lapu ielādes laiks dažādās nozarēs (avots).

Pārbaudiet vietnes ātrumu

Lai sāktu, pārbaudiet, cik ātri vispirms tiek ielādēta jūsu vietne. Daži ieteiktie rīki ir:

  • WebPageTest: apkopojiet tīmekļa lapu veiktspēju no reāliem pārlūkiem, kuros darbojas kopīgas operētājsistēmas.
  • Pingdom: palīdz analizēt un atrast vājās vietas tīmekļa vietnes darbībā.
  • GTmetrix: analizējiet un piedāvājiet praktiskas iespējas par labāko Web lapas ātruma optimizācijas veidu.
  • Bitcatcha: pārbaudiet vietnes ātrumu no astoņām valstīm.

Izmantojot vietnes ātruma testeri, jūs varēsit uzzināt, cik labi jūsu vietne šobrīd ir optimizēta.

Šeit ir padomi, kā paātrināt vietni …

1. Izvēlieties Lielo Web Host

Pēc manas pieredzes tīmekļa mitināšana ir varbūt viena no vissvarīgākajām izvēlēm, kas jums būs jāizdara. Ir tīmekļa mitinātāji, un tad ir lieliski tīmekļa mitinātāji. Katrai tīmekļa mitinātājai būs atšķirīgas funkcijas, tāpēc pievērsiet uzmanību galvenajiem elementiem, piemēram, patentētām kešatmiņas tehnoloģijām, cietvielu diskdziņiem vai kritisko zonu, piemēram, NGINX, kontrolei..

Es to nevaru pietiekami uzsvērt. Tīmekļa mitinātāja izvēle ir kritiski svarīga. Ja jūs neesat pazīstams ar viņiem, apskatiet mūsu visaptverošus pārskatus par labākajiem tīmekļa mitinātājiem, lai palīdzētu jums pieņemt labi informētu lēmumu.

2. Minifikācija: mazāks ir labāks

Mūsdienās vietnēs ir ierasts pārpildīt Javascript un CSS failus. Tas vizītes laikā rada ļoti daudz HTTP pieprasījumu, kas, iespējams, ievērojami palēnina jūsu vietnes darbību. Šajā vietā nāk minifikācija.

Javascript un CSS failu saīsināšana tiek veikta, apvienojot visus skriptus vienā failā (no katra veida). Tas nav viegls uzdevums, taču neuztraucieties, ir WordPress spraudņi, kas ar jums var tikt galā.

Izmēģiniet kādu no šiem, lai sāktu ar: Automātiska optimizācija, ātrs ātruma samazinājums vai sapludināšana + samazināšana + atsvaidzināšana

Samazināšana var izraisīt to, ka kods izskatās viss sabojājies – neuztraucieties! Tas ir normāli.

3. Ievērojiet KISS principu

Tas nav kaut kas tāds, ko parasti māca vairums tīmekļa guru, bet es uzskatu, ka tas ir ārkārtīgi noderīgs tik daudzos veidos. KISS ir saīsinājums no vārda “Vienkārši, muļķīgi”. To 60. gados izdomāja kāda vieda nodaļa, kas uzsvēra vienkāršu sistēmu efektivitāti.

Kā īkšķis, es uzskatu, ka tas attiecas uz gandrīz visu dzīvē – pat uz vietņu iestatīšanu. Izvairoties no pārāk sarežģītām ieviešanām un dizainiem, jūs iegūsit no vietnes, kas ir ātra un vēl svarīgāka, viegli pārvaldāma un uzturējama..

Dizains & Vizuāli

Saglabājot savu dizainu un vizuālo vienkāršo, es domāju galvenokārt to, lai samazinātu pieskaitāmās izmaksas. Vietne, kurā ir daudz masīvu, elpu aizraujošu attēlu un satriecošu video, iespējams, ielādēsies tikpat ātri kā slinkums sliktā dienā. Glabājiet to kārtīgi un kārtīgi, mēģiniet sadalīt video un attēlu dažādās lapās.

Kods & Spraudņi

WordPress ir tik brīnišķīga lieta, jo tā ir ļoti modulāra un tomēr tik vienkārši lietojama. Neatkarīgi no tā, ko vēlaties darīt, iespējams, kāds jau ir izveidojis tam spraudni.

Tikpat aizraujoši, kā izklausās, esiet piesardzīgs, ja vietne tiek pārslogota ar spraudņiem. Atcerieties, ka katru spraudni ir izstrādājuši dažādi cilvēki (un, iespējams, dažādi uzņēmumi). To mērķis ir sasniegt konkrētu mērķi, nevis pilnveidot vietnes veiktspēju.

Ja varat, izvairieties no spraudņiem lietās, kuras varat pārvaldīt pats. Piemēram, spraudnis, kas palīdzēs iespraust tabulas tekstā. Varat viegli iemācīties HTML pamatkodu, lai sastādītu tabulas, tā vietā, lai pareizi izmantotu spraudni?

Daži atsevišķi spraudņi var ievērojami palēnināt jūsu vietnes darbību, tāpēc pārliecinieties, ka katru reizi, instalējot jaunu spraudni, veicat ātruma pārbaudi!

4. Sviras efekts satura piegādes tīklos

Man satura piegādes tīkli ir dievu dāvana. Uzņēmumi, piemēram, Cloudflare un LimeLight Networks, nopelna iztiku, palīdzot citām tautām izbaudīt stabilu un ātru satura piegādi visā pasaulē esošo serveru tīklos..

Izmantojot CDN, jūs varēsit daudz ātrāk apkalpot savas tīmekļa lapas un uzlabot ielādēšanas ātrumu neatkarīgi no tā, kur pasaulē apmeklētāji nāk.

Turklāt CDN izmantošana piedāvā arī papildu aizsardzību pret tādiem ļaunprātīgiem uzbrukumiem kā izplatīts pakalpojumu atteikums (DDoS)..

Ja esat nelielas vietnes īpašnieks, tad Cloudflare ir bezmaksas opcija, kuru varat izmantot un kas darbojas lieliski. Uzņēmumiem un lielākām vietnēm būs jāmaksā, lai iegūtu labāku plānu, taču, ņemot vērā CND iezīmes, tā ir cenas vērta!

5. Izmantojiet kešatmiņu

Kešatmiņā notiek tieši tā, kā izklausās – statisko failu glabāšana, lai apmeklētājiem līdzi dodoties, jūsu vietne varētu koplietot no iepriekš izveidotām lapām, lai apstrādes laiks tiktu saīsināts. Vairumā gadījumu tas, kas jums jāinteresē, ir servera puses kešatmiņa.

Visefektīvākais veids servera puses kešatmiņas ieviešanai ir Apache vai NGINX servera iestatījumi. Jums būs jāiziet šie dokumenti un jāatrod pareizie iestatījumi, kas palīdzēs iestatīt servera kešatmiņu.

Īkšķu noteikums ir tāds, ka viss, kas prasa lielu servera atbalsta darbu (apstrādi), ja tas ir iespējams, jāglabā kešatmiņā.

Ja tas jums liekas pārāk dīvaini, spraudņi ir vēl viena iespēja, bet es atkal neiesakām jums šajā gadījumā izmantot..

6. Attēli Hog Joslas platums, optimizējiet savu!

Tas nedaudz papildina manu iepriekšējo runu par masveida attēliem un video pēc KISS principa. Ņemot vērā to, es saprotu, ka vizuālie attēli ir galvenie, lai vietne izskatās glīta. Tā kā mēs nevaram pilnībā izvairīties no to izmantošanas, pārliecināsimies, vai izmantotie attēli ir pēc iespējas pilnveidoti,

Web saturs lielākoties ir pamata, pat ja tas attiecas uz attēliem. Lielāko daļu manis sastapto vietņu, piemēram, mirstošas ​​cūkas, bieži vien velk masīvi attēli, kuriem nav reāla mērķa.

Es nesaku, ka jums nevar būt lielāki attēli, taču pirms to augšupielādes pārliecinieties, vai tie ir pareizi optimizēti.

To var izdarīt divos veidos. Atkal pirmais ir caur spraudni, piemēram, WP Smush. Alternatīva vai tiem, kas nelieto WordPress, ir trešo pušu attēlu optimizācijas rīks, piemēram, Image Compressor vai JPEG Optimizer.

Lielākā daļa attēlu optimizācijas rīku ļaus jums precīzi pielāgot attēlu izšķirtspējas detaļas, lai jūs varētu to pakāpeniski tonizēt. Viņi izskatīsies gandrīz vienādi ar neapmācītu aci, taču daudz mazāki.

Tie tiek tuvināti HD attēla apgabalos (pa kreisi). Oriģināls bija 2,3 MB, un pēc optimizācijas tas tika samazināts līdz 331 kb!

7. Izmantojiet gzip Compression

Ja esat dzirdējis par attēlu saspiešanu vai varbūt arhivēšanu (ZIP vai RAR), tad, iespējams, esat iepazinies ar gzip saspiešanas teoriju. Tādējādi tiek saspiests jūsu vietnes kods, līdz ar to palielinot ātrumu līdz 300% (rezultāti atšķiras).

Pat kaut ko tik tehnisku kā šis, jūs varat iet uz priekšu un izmantot tādu spraudni kā PageSpeed ​​Ninja. Tomēr ir daudz efektīvāka metode, kas paredz .htaccess faila rediģēšanu tikai vienu reizi.

Pievienojiet zemāk redzamo kodu savam .htaccess failam, un jūs tiksit iestatīts:

# Saspiest HTML, CSS, JavaScript, tekstu, XML un fontus

AddOutputFilterByType DEFLATE lietojumprogramma / javascript

AddOutputFilterByType programma DEFLATE / rss + xml

AddOutputFilterByType DEFLATE lietojumprogramma / vnd.ms-fontobject

AddOutputFilterByType lietojumprogramma DEFLATE / x-font

AddOutputFilterByType DEFLATE lietojumprogramma / x-font-opentype

AddOutputFilterByType DEFLATE lietojumprogramma / x-font-otf

AddOutputFilterByType DEFLATE lietojumprogramma / x-font-truetype

AddOutputFilterByType DEFLATE lietojumprogramma / x-font-ttf

AddOutputFilterByType DEFLATE lietojumprogramma / x-javascript

AddOutputFilterByType programma DEFLATE / xhtml + xml

AddOutputFilterByType lietojumprogramma DEFLATE / xml

AddOutputFilterByType DEFLATE fonts / opentype

AddOutputFilterByType DEFLATE fonts / otf

AddOutputFilterByType DEFLATE font / ttf

AddOutputFilterByType DEFLATE attēls / svg + xml

AddOutputFilterByType DEFLATE attēls / x-ikona

AddOutputFilterByType DEFLATE text / css

AddOutputFilterByType DEFLATE text / html

AddOutputFilterByType DEFLATE teksts / javascript

AddOutputFilterByType DEFLATE teksts / vienkāršs

AddOutputFilterByType DEFLATE teksts / xml

* Piezīme. Pārliecinieties, vai esat pievienojis šo kodu zemāk esošajām lietām, kuras jums pašlaik ir .htaccess failā.

8. Novirzīšanas samazināšana

Parasti pārlūkprogrammas pieņem dažāda veida adreses, kuras jūsu serveris savukārt pārtulko oficiāli atzītajās adresēs. Piemēram, www.example.com un example.com. Abas var doties uz vienu un to pašu vietni, bet vienai ir nepieciešams, lai jūsu serveris to novirzītu uz oficiāli atzīto adresi.

Šī novirzīšana prasa zināmu laiku un resursus, tāpēc jūsu mērķis ir nodrošināt, lai vietne būtu pieejama, izmantojot ne vairāk kā vienu novirzīšanu. Izmantojiet šo novirzīšanas kartētāju, lai redzētu, vai jūs to darāt pareizi.

Ņemot vērā šo tiesību veikšanas sarežģītību un pastāvīgi iesaistīto laiku, šī ir viena reize, kurā es ieteiktu izmantot tādu spraudni kā Redirection.

Ātrākas vietnes priecē apmeklētājus (un Google)

Mūsdienās platjoslas ātrums, pat mobilajā telefonā, ir pieaudzis tik daudz un pieaugs vēl vairāk. Tas nozīmē, ka vietņu īpašniekiem ir atlicis ļoti maz attaisnojuma, lai viņu apmeklētāji spētu lēnām ielādēt vietnes.

Ticiet man, jūs zaudēsit apmeklētājus un vienā brīdī iegūsit tik sliktu reputāciju, ka jūs dēvēs par “Ak, TĀDA vietne”. Ja jūs veicat uzņēmējdarbību tiešsaistē, tas vēl vairāk pasliktinās, jo jūs nogalināsit savu zelta zosu.

Lai arī iepriekš minētie 8 sniegtie padomi nekādā ziņā nav visi un beidzas visi, tomēr tas jums sniegs sākumu un dažas idejas, kā lietas pārvaldīt mazliet labāk. Paātriniet savu vietni jau šodien un saglabājiet klientus vai apmeklētājus.

Nebeidziet kā TĀDA vietne.

Jeffrey Wilson Administrator
Sorry! The Author has not filled his profile.
follow me
    Like this post? Please share to your friends:
    Adblock
    detector
    map